When doctors determine if someone has diabetes, they look at glucose levels in the blood. If you’ve reached a certain threshold, you’re a diabetic, and if not you may be labelled prediabetic if your glucose falls into a certain range.
Dr. Martin thinks there’s no such thing as prediabetes. If you’re like 93% of the population who has metabolic syndrome, you’re likely already a diabetic. Having your A1C looked at can easily determine the diagnosis. Learn more in today’s episode.
